Koah, a burgeoning artificial intelligence startup, has successfully secured $5 million in funding to revolutionize the monetization landscape for AI-powered applications. The investment, whose specifics remain undisclosed, positions Koah as a key player in addressing the critical challenge of generating revenue within the rapidly expanding AI app ecosystem. One unnamed investor succinctly summarized Koah's potential, describing the company as "building the essential monetization layer for consumer AI."
This strategic funding round underscores the growing recognition of the need for sophisticated and user-friendly monetization strategies within the AI sector. While the proliferation of AI-driven applications is undeniable, creating sustainable business models capable of balancing user experience with revenue generation remains a significant hurdle. Koah aims to overcome this challenge by seamlessly integrating advertising into AI apps without compromising the user experience, a delicate balance that many developers struggle to achieve.
The core of Koah's technology lies in its proprietary algorithms that analyze user interactions and contextual data within AI applications to deliver highly targeted and relevant advertisements. This approach stands in contrast to more intrusive and disruptive advertising methods prevalent in many free-to-use applications. The company's focus is on creating an advertising experience that is both effective for advertisers and unobtrusive for end-users, aiming for a win-win scenario rarely seen in the often-contentious relationship between consumers and advertising.

The current trend in the AI app market sees a heavy reliance on freemium models or subscription services, both of which present limitations. Freemium models often struggle to generate substantial revenue, while subscription models can be a barrier to entry for many users. Koah’s approach offers a viable alternative, unlocking the potential of a larger market by making AI apps more accessible through a more sustainable revenue model.
